Eitan Yaakobi is a Professor in the Computer Science Department at the Technion – Israel Institute of Technology, with a courtesy appointment in the Electrical and Computer Engineering (ECE) Department. He holds affiliations with the University of California, San Diego (UCSD) Center for Memory and Recording Research and previously served at the Technical University of Munich’s Institute of Advanced Studies under a Hans Fischer Fellowship. His roles include Associate Editor for IEEE Transactions on Information Theory and IEEE Transactions on Molecular, Biological, and Multi-Scale Communications.
Education: B.A. and M.Sc. in Computer Science and Mathematics from Technion (2005–2007), Ph.D. in Electrical Engineering from UCSD (2011). Postdoctoral research at Caltech (2011–2013). Awards include the Marconi Society Young Scholar Award and Intel Ph.D. Fellowship. He has secured grants such as the ERC Consolidator Grant and EIC Pathfinder Challenge.
Research focuses on coding and information theory applications in non-volatile memories, DNA storage, distributed systems, and privacy-preserving data retrieval. Teaching spans courses like Coding Algorithms for Memories and Seminars on DNA Data Storage. Office hours: Wednesdays 11:30–12:30.
